Transaction d6a220a87bd14efce0c9a83cd0562199b7565e4652357361e4e8436b2ae60823
1 Input
1 Output
-
d6a220a87bd14efce0c9a83cd0562199b7565e4652357361e4e8436b2ae60823:0
- value
- 10308465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 075dc2a08ba15a45097b7c61ddeff2f30b217b08 OP_EQUAL
- address
- 32MxyTrTZ3Tsvkw2wV8daVTHbEwYdXPxEB